The honeycomb rocks were formed 2-300 million years ago and present a world class and spectacular example of quartz boxwork Hematite deposits. The gravel surfaced trail is graded and maintained at less than a 5% grade. Many interpretive signs are to be found along the trail. A small parking area is located at the trailhead. The GPS coordinates are for that parking area. Plan on 30 minutes or so to fully enjoy the site.
